The specificity of the process of standardization is considered for multilayer building glass as an example. The range of glasses used in the building industry has substantially widened in recent years, in many countries. Various visionproof, coloured, film-coated, multilayer and figured glasses, devitrified glass ceramic tile, and other products have appeared on the market. Each of these proudcts has characteristics that distinguish it from the other ones and is useful for the consumer. At the same time, all of them should meet general requirements ensuring the safety of their use, interchangeability, and compatiability with other products. Therefore, standardization is a very important stage in the development and production of new materials. (article refers to International standards)
